Le Protocole de Commerce Universel (UCP) est le standard de formatage et de transaction conçu pour traduire directement les flux de travail de tarification, de disponibilité et d'exécution pour l'intelligence artificielle.
1. Pourquoi les parcours de paiement e-commerce traditionnels échouent pour les bots
Les parcours de paiement B2B traditionnels exigent de remplir des formulaires HTML en plusieurs étapes, de résoudre les surcharges d'expédition cachées, d'attendre les e-mails de confirmation de vente et de traiter les factures PDF manuelles. Alors que les humains peuvent franchir ces obstacles visuels, les agents d'IA autonomes ne peuvent pas le faire de manière fiable. L'UCP résout ce problème en standardisant la négociation commerciale en un échange JSON unique et signé.
2. Comparaison des protocoles : Traditionnel vs. UCP
| Caractéristique | Parcours de paiement traditionnel | UCP (Optimisé pour l'IA) |
|---|---|---|
| Interface | Formulaires HTML visuels, Captchas, Pop-ups de cookies | Point de terminaison de manifeste JSON-RPC / SSE unifié |
| Latence | Minutes (Navigation humaine, chargement de pages) | Millisecondes (Négociation API directe) |
| Vérification | Approbation manuelle, validation NIP via formulaires | Signatures d'identité cryptographiques (Ed25519) |
3. Le schéma du manifeste UCP
Chaque nœud conforme à l'UCP expose un manifeste public qui décrit ses produits et ses règles d'achat. Ce schéma permet aux modèles LLM de comprendre programmatiquement les contraintes de transaction sans avoir à lire de manuels PDF.
- Identité du nœud commercial : Données marchandes et règles de paiement vérifiées cryptographiquement.
- Matrice de prix : Niveaux de prix basés sur le volume, QMC (Quantités Minimales de Commande) et conversions de devises en temps réel.
- Point de terminaison de négociation : URL directe et sécurisée pour soumettre des achats automatisés et vérifier le stock.
4. Flux de travail d'intégration étape par étape
La mise en place de l'UCP sur votre plateforme B2B implique trois phases techniques principales :
- Déployer le fichier manifeste : Exposer le fichier
ucp.jsonà la racine de votre domaine (ex :domain.com/ucp.json). - Connecter la passerelle UCP : Lier votre base de données d'inventaire au serveur de passerelle pour signaler dynamiquement les mises à jour de stock.
- Vérifier OAuth et les webhooks : Configurer les gestionnaires de webhooks pour traiter les jetons d'achat et envoyer le suivi d'expédition en temps réel.
Pour consulter les spécifications complètes, vous pouvez voir le dépôt open-source officiel sur Scopio GitHub.
